From the
New York Times
bestselling author Kwame Alexander comes
Rebound,
the dynamic prequel to his Newbery Award–winning novel in verse,
The Crossover.
Before Josh and Jordan Bell were streaking up and down the court, their father was learning his own moves. Chuck Bell takes center stage as readers get a glimpse of his childhood and how he became the jazz music worshiping, basketball star his sons look up to.
A novel in verse with all the impact and rhythm readers have come to expect from Kwame Alexander,
Rebound
goes back in time to visit the childhood of Chuck "Da Man" Bell during one pivotal summer when young Charlie is sent to stay with his grandparents where he discovers basketball and learns more about his family's past.
This prequel to the Newbery Medal- and Coretta Scott King Award-winning
The Crossover
scores.
